Concrete basement pouring services involve the installation of a solid concrete slab to form the foundation of a basement space. This service is commonly used for new construction projects, basement finishing, or foundation repairs. Property owners typically request this service to create a durable, level surface that supports flooring, walls, or additional structural elements. Before requesting a concrete basement pour, homeowners should consider factors such as the size and layout of the basement, soil conditions, and any specific requirements for drainage or insulation to ensure the project meets their needs.
Understanding the scope of the project is essential for property owners planning a basement pour. It’s important to determine whether the work involves a full basement foundation or a smaller slab for a specific area, such as a workshop or storage space. Additionally, property owners should be aware of the importance of proper site preparation, including excavation and form setting, to ensure the concrete is poured correctly and will provide a long-lasting foundation. Clarifying these details can help facilitate a smooth process and a finished result that aligns with the property’s structural and functional goals.

Concrete Basement Pouring Questions
What is involved in pouring a concrete basement? The process includes preparing the foundation area, setting formwork, pouring the concrete, and finishing the surface for durability and smoothness.
Can concrete basement pouring be done for existing homes? Yes, it is possible to add or replace basement floors in existing structures with proper planning and preparation.
What are common uses for a poured concrete basement? Typical uses include additional living space, storage, workshops, or finishing for a basement area.
What should property owners consider before pouring a basement? Ensuring proper drainage, soil stability, and adherence to local building codes helps achieve a solid and lasting foundation.
